46 employees at Webster Bank have reviewed Webster Bank across various culture dimensions, providing their opinions on items ranging from executive ratings to the pace at work. The latest review was months ago.
Overall, the 46 Webster Bank employees give their leadership a grade of B-, or Top 40% of similar size companies on Comparably. This includes specific ratings of their executive team, CEO, and manager.
Employees at Webster Bank are not very pleased with their total compensation at Webster Bank, which includes a combination of pay, stock and equity, and benefits.
Overall, employees at Webster Bank are pleased with their team. 46 Participants grade the quality of their coworkers a B. The majority believe the meetings at Webster Bank are effective, and the majority look forward to interacting with their coworkers.
The majority of employees at Webster Bank believe the environment at Webster Bank is positive. Most Participants believe the pace of work at Webster Bank is extremely fast. About 57% of the employees at Webster Bank work 8 hours or less, while 19% of them have an extremely long day - longer than twelve hours.
Overall, the employees at Webster Bank are not very happy, based on their aggregated ratings of future outlook, customer perception, and their excitement going to work.

The prevailing opinion from employees about joining Webster Bank is that the company was somewhat prepared on their first day. Webster Bank employees concluded that their overall onboarding experience was positive. First impressions are important, and how prepared a company is on your first day leaves a lasting impression.

How much do people at Webster Bank get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at Webster Bank is $117,677, or $56 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$114,039, or $54 per hour.
At Webster Bank, the highest paid job is a Director of Sales at $212,790 annually and the lowest is an Admin Assistant at $47,640 annually. Average Webster Bank salaries by department include: Finance at $88,516, IT at $104,263, Admin at $54,313, and Sales at $149,928. Half of Webster Bank salaries are above $114,039.
19 employees at Webster Bank rank their Compensation in the Bottom 40% of similar sized companies in the US (based on 55 ratings) while 18 employees at Webster Bank rank their Perks And Benefits in the Top 50% of similar sized companies in the US (based on 18 ratings).
